Question 1: The EPA's Reference Dose (RfD) is defined as an estimate of daily exposure that:
- Causes a 1-in-a-million cancer risk over a lifetime
- Is likely to be without appreciable risk of deleterious effects over a lifetime (Correct answer)
- Represents the average human daily intake from all sources
- Is the LOAEL divided by an uncertainty factor of 10
Correct answer: Is likely to be without appreciable risk of deleterious effects over a lifetime
The RfD is an EPA estimate of daily oral exposure to a chemical that is likely to be without appreciable deleterious effects over a lifetime, used for non-carcinogens.
Question 2: Methylmercury exposure in humans primarily occurs through:
- Inhalation of industrial emissions
- Consumption of contaminated fish and seafood (Correct answer)
- Dermal contact with thermometers
- Drinking water from industrial runoff
Correct answer: Consumption of contaminated fish and seafood
Methylmercury bioaccumulates in fish and seafood, making dietary consumption of large predatory fish (tuna, swordfish) the primary human exposure route.
Question 3: Which class of pesticides inhibits acetylcholinesterase and was originally developed as nerve agents?
- Pyrethroids
- Organochlorines
- Organophosphates (Correct answer)
- Neonicotinoids
Correct answer: Organophosphates
Organophosphate pesticides are structurally related to nerve agents and inhibit acetylcholinesterase, causing accumulation of acetylcholine at synapses.
Question 4: Lead exposure in children is most commonly associated with which source in older US homes?
- Drinking water from copper pipes
- Lead-based paint chips and dust (Correct answer)
- Gasoline combustion residues in soil
- Food packaging leachates
Correct answer: Lead-based paint chips and dust
Lead-based paint used in homes built before 1978 is the most common source of lead exposure in US children through ingestion of paint chips and inhalation of dust.
Question 5: Dioxins (PCDDs) exert their toxic effects primarily through which molecular mechanism?
- Direct DNA alkylation
- Inhibition of cytochrome oxidase
- Activation of the aryl hydrocarbon receptor (AhR) (Correct answer)
- Disruption of sodium channel gating
Correct answer: Activation of the aryl hydrocarbon receptor (AhR)
Dioxins bind with high affinity to the aryl hydrocarbon receptor (AhR), a ligand-activated transcription factor that alters gene expression leading to diverse toxic effects.
Question 6: The 'cancer slope factor' (CSF) is used in risk assessment to estimate risk for which type of toxic endpoint?
- Threshold-based systemic toxicity
- Neurotoxicity endpoints only
- Linearized low-dose carcinogenicity risk (Correct answer)
- Reproductive toxicity endpoints
Correct answer: Linearized low-dose carcinogenicity risk
The cancer slope factor (CSF) is used in the linearized multistage model to estimate the incremental lifetime cancer risk per unit of daily exposure for carcinogens.
